Subject: [PATCH v2 1/2] pci: Call pcibios_sriov_enable() before IOV BARs are enabled
Date: Fri, 30 Sep 2016 09:47:49 +1000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1475192870-7763-1-git-send-email-gwshan@linux.vnet.ibm.com> (raw)
In current implementation, pcibios_sriov_enable() is used by PPC
PowerNV platform only. In PowerNV specific pcibios_sriov_enable(),
PF's IOV BARs might be updated (shifted) by pci_update_resource().
It means the IOV BARs aren't ready for decoding incoming memory
address until pcibios_sriov_enable() returns.
This calls pcibios_sriov_enable() earlier before the IOV BARs are
enabled. As the result, the IOV BARs have been configured correctly
when they are enabled.

drivers/pci/iov.c | 14 +++++++-------
1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/pci/iov.c b/drivers/pci/iov.c
index 2194b44..f1343f0 100644
--- a/drivers/pci/iov.c
+++ b/drivers/pci/iov.c
@@ -303,13 +303,6 @@ static int sriov_enable(struct pci_dev *dev, int nr_virtfn)
return rc;
}
- pci_iov_set_numvfs(dev, nr_virtfn);
- iov->ctrl |= PCI_SRIOV_CTRL_VFE | PCI_SRIOV_CTRL_MSE;
- pci_cfg_access_lock(dev);
- pci_write_config_word(dev, iov->pos + PCI_SRIOV_CTRL, iov->ctrl);
- msleep(100);
- pci_cfg_access_unlock(dev);
-
iov->initial_VFs = initial;
if (nr_virtfn < initial)
initial = nr_virtfn;
@@ -320,6 +313,13 @@ static int sriov_enable(struct pci_dev *dev, int nr_virtfn)
goto err_pcibios;
}
+ pci_iov_set_numvfs(dev, nr_virtfn);
+ iov->ctrl |= PCI_SRIOV_CTRL_VFE | PCI_SRIOV_CTRL_MSE;
+ pci_cfg_access_lock(dev);
+ pci_write_config_word(dev, iov->pos + PCI_SRIOV_CTRL, iov->ctrl);
+ msleep(100);
+ pci_cfg_access_unlock(dev);
+
for (i = 0; i < initial; i++) {
rc = pci_iov_add_virtfn(dev, i, 0);
if (rc)
